Released in 1996, in a time when developers didn't knew the console limits or how good graphics should look and work, Tobal had anime-like designs by Akira Toriyama rendered with very few textures and blocky models that mixed flat shading with gourad shading. Some characters parts are smooth, most are blocky. The game also uses vertex colors. While Spyro uses vertex colors only on skyboxes with really good results, Tobal uses vertex colors on the stages, and this gives the game an weird ethereal quality that clashes with the blocky models.
Maybe some would call it "vaporwave".
Post weird and "off" looking games. And I'm not talking shit looking games like Playstation SimCity 2000
The sequel went for a more normal look with simple textures with smooth shading and really boring flat 2D stages.
